Musical Wooden Table Toys Recalled by Battat Due to Choking Hazard

11342 · Recalled 2011-09-29 · CPSC page

Description

This recall involves Battat's Musical Wooden Table toys. The table has a green painted surface and colorful instruments affixed to the top. The table stands about 7 1/2-inches tall and has three supporting legs. Instruments on the table include a xylophone, cymbal, drum and two drumsticks.

Hazards

Small pegs on the xylophone toy can loosen and detach, posing a choking hazard to young children.

Reported injuries

CPSC and Battat have received nine reports of loose and detached pegs. No injuries have been reported.

Remedy

Consumers should immediately take the recalled toys away from children and contact Battat to receive a refund.
